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2006.02.12;
Скачать: CL | DM;

Вниз

KERNEL32.DLL   Найти похожие ветки 

 
medvedenator ©   (2006-01-25 16:41) [0]

Я написал скрипт, который по нажатию на кнопку прятал/показывал процесс в диспетчере. Кто скажет почему вылазит ошибка:"Точка входа в процедуру RegiiterServiceProcess не найдена в библиотеке DLL KERNEL32.DLL",

Скрипт:
function RegisterServiceProcess(dwProcessID, dwType: Integer):
  Integer; stdcall; external "KERNEL32.DLL";

implementation

{$R *.dfm}

procedure TForm1.Button1Click(Sender: TObject);
begin
if not (csDesigning in ComponentState) then
RegisterServiceProcess(GetCurrentProcessID, 1);
end;

procedure TForm1.Button2Click(Sender: TObject);
begin
if not (csDesigning in ComponentState) then
RegisterServiceProcess(GetCurrentProcessID, 0);
end;


 
azl ©   (2006-01-25 16:45) [1]

Это работает в Windows 98, Millennium в 2000 и XP не работает. В 2000/XP невозможно спрятать процесс. Но можно заблокировать кнопку Диспетчер задач.


 
begin...end ©   (2006-01-25 16:45) [2]

Функция RegisterServiceProcess отсутствует в NT-системах...


 
WST   (2006-01-28 02:05) [3]

Вообще, есть способ! Только, если надо, на мыло вышлю! Zdmitry@inbox.ru



Страницы: 1 вся ветка

Текущий архив: 2006.02.12;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.034 c
1-1137267609
Alex17
2006-01-14 22:40
2006.02.12
Как это выгледит в Дельфи


15-1137904711
AllinBDA
2006-01-22 07:38
2006.02.12
Компоненты или заголовки для Фиксального Регистра. "Феликс 3СК"


15-1137909887
begin...end
2006-01-22 09:04
2006.02.12
С Днём рождения! 22 января


15-1137610275
Ксардас
2006-01-18 21:51
2006.02.12
Подскажите прогу...


2-1138006484
ИвашкаИзПросквашки
2006-01-23 11:54
2006.02.12
Timer в Сервисе